I just bought a Mazda 3s 4-dr. MSRP was $17k, paid $15,900. Great 5-speed man., 2.3 liter 160-hp, 150 lb-ft DOHC variable valve timing. Great low end power and love the overall power curve. Plus, I paid less than $16k and got power window/lock w/remote, great styling (cool rear lense covers front projector beam headlights, fog lights, radio volume is speed-sensitive). PLUS, the Mazda 3 is a JAPANESE Mazda (90% Japanese parts - manufactured and assembled in Japan), not a Detroit-buildt, Ford-powered piece of crap wrapped in a cool body (a.k.a. Mazda 6). To keep the price low I opted out of the side air bags and ABS. The Civic EX has a sunroof and ABS for about 17,500 but Honda dealers probably wont negotiate too much on the price. Plus the Civic EX only has 127 horsepower and they are EVERYWHERE. I get tons of compliments on my 3s. At the car wash the other day I had 3 guys come over and ask me about it...they loved it. i just bought a new mazda 3 in australia but we have 4 versions. poverty pack, maxx, maxx sport and sp23. 1st 3 come with 2.0l and usual options but i got sp23. 2.3l vvt, full bodykit, 17 inche wheels, cd stacker, climate control, 6 airbags and leather trim wheel and knob all standard. cruise and parking sensors optional. BEST car i've ever had allround.
in response to wpbharry i'm 6'4 and i fit in just fine because the seat has a lowering lever. all the way up and i don't fit. all he way down and i don't see over the bonnet.and i still fit in the back. ive had 4 guys all 6'2+ and 220lbs in it all comfortable
power is good and smooth.(not super quick due to weight) but quiet and responsive and good handling and brakes. (heaps of rear brake dust)
